    Job Description:

    As a Child and Adolescent Therapist at our center, you will:

    Provide individual and group therapy sessions tailored to children and adolescents

    Experience with children with ASD and ADHD is a must.

    Utilize a variety of therapeutic techniques including play therapy, art therapy, and potentially animal-assisted therapy, depending on your skills and certifications.

    Develop and implement treatment plans that cater to individual needs, monitor progress, and adjust as necessary.

    Maintain up-to-date records of therapy sessions and client progress in compliance with legal and organizational standards.

    Participate in ongoing professional development and training to ensure best practices in pediatric mental health care.

    Qualifications:

    A valid professional license as a Licensed Professional Counselor (LPC),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W), or equivalent in your jurisdiction.

    Master’s degree in psychology, counseling, social work, or a related field.

    At least 2 years of direct clinical experience working with children and adolescents, specifically with ASD and ADHD.

    Trained in specialized therapeutic approaches such as play therapy, art therapy, or animal-assisted therapy (certification preferred).

    Strong communication skills and the ability to work effectively with a diverse team and client base.

    A compassionate and patient approach to therapeutic engagement with young clients.
